Program Overview

The BEng (Hons) Biomedical Engineering at the University of Exeter is a new three-year degree launching in 2025, designed to blend engineering principles with medical applications. Developed in collaboration with industry experts and accreditation bodies, the course offers a strong focus on project-based learning, interdisciplinary problem-solving, and entrepreneurial thinking from the first year. Students benefit from the university’s research excellence and modern lab facilities, with a curriculum structured to provide the technical and professional skills needed to enter the rapidly growing healthcare technology sector.

  • Ranked Top 10 in the UK for General Engineering by both the Complete University Guide 2025 and The Times and Sunday Times Good University Guide 2025. 
  • Teaching Format: Lectures, labs, group projects, workshops

Course overview

  • Year 1: Engineering Mathematics and Scientific Computing, Multi-Disciplinary Group Challenge Project, Fundamentals of Mechanics, Materials and Electronics

  • Year 2: Introduction to Fluid Dynamics, Modelling of Engineering Systems, Solid Mechanics, Biomedical Engineering Challenge Project

  • Year 3: Mechatronics, Individual Project, Digital Signal Processing, along with optional modules

Experiential Learning (Research, Projects, Internships etc.)

  • Project Work: Group challenge projects in Years 1 and 2; major individual capstone project in Year 3

  • Industry Collaboration: Curriculum shaped with input from healthcare technology companies

  • Entrepreneurship Training: Modules in business and leadership embedded from Year 1

  • Hands-on Practice: Practical lab work and use of microcontrollers, simulation tools, and advanced manufacturing software

Progression & Future Opportunities

  • Pursue a career in medical device development, clinical engineering, biomechanics, biomaterials, rehabilitation engineering, or pharmaceutical technology.

  • Opportunities in industries such as healthcare, medical imaging, diagnostics, prosthetics, and wearable health technologies.

  • Further academic study through taught master's degrees (e.g., MSc Biomedical Engineering, MSc Medical Physics), research degrees (MPhil/PhD), or medical school entry for qualified candidates.

  • Potential to register as a Chartered Engineer (CEng) with an accredited MEng or appropriate combination of BEng and MSc, enhancing professional standing.
